Did you know that the Center for Food, Youth & Community will be able to operate 12 days without grid access, in the case of a public safety power shutoff? This will allow us to continue to make and preserve thousands of medically tailored meals, even without power, and serve those such as our client, Sara!
“After surviving a horrific surgery I underwent 9 months of chemotherapy and even with strong support from friends and family, it was the Ceres program that made a huge difference in my daily life. The healthful, nurturing foods delivered with such grace by volunteers sustained me, and I believe hastened my recovery...Ceres is truly an amazing organization on so many levels. It is a great blessing to our community and a sound model for the rest of the country.” ~Client Sara
This is just one of the many great benefits our upcoming Center for Food, Youth and Community will have. Our future home is vital for allowing Ceres to continue expanding and meet growing needs in our community as efficiently and cost-effectively as possible.
